Transaction 5f8d3afb9d1820b4ac50d61e01e77aba95a4a633787d9727b2f77dd990705770
1 Input
1 Output
-
5f8d3afb9d1820b4ac50d61e01e77aba95a4a633787d9727b2f77dd990705770:0
- value
- 27559192
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 909526cbba169970c8e34b60f1973df1f2bf1333 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EBUyraAHGAvA1g3cyurihXUTMKGkDrKFX